It's actually not given to Google in a user identifiable way. I am not privy to the details, but an overview was presented at a crypto conference:
https://www.youtube.com/watch?v=ee7oRsDnNNc&t=10m1sIt looks to me like a form of homomorphic encryption where both the aggregate consumer transactions (people bought X at merchant M), and the aggregate Google ad information (people saw ad for X at merchant M) are encrypted and the set intersection is computed on the ciphertext revealing only the aggregate number of purchases, not the individuals.
Now granted, there could be a security hole in this scheme as with any crypto-protocol, so it does need peer review, but the design, as stated in that YouTube presentation, is not to reveal to Google personal purchasing information, nor reveal to merchants, personal profile information. No personal financial data or purchasing information is supposedly transmitted.
The problem with this kind of technology is that it is really difficult to explain to the public, and easily demagogued.
